Laundry room plumbing tips

You do not have to be a plumbing to understand a little about your washing machine. This helpful device makes our lives a lot easier, it's essential that we treat it well so it remains in good condition for years to come. A simple way to keep your machine running efficiently is to check its pipes. If you discover signs of wear, think about changing old rubber hoses with ones made from braided stainless-steel. These more recent materials will last longer and are much less likely to crack or leak. In order to identify something incorrect, watch on your washing machine water line. If you see this line drastically changing you may have a clog or other problem within your washer. Call Midwest Plumbers and we'll send an expert to examine and deal with the problem right away.

A common problem that accompanies a washer is that the drain line will block with hair and other debris from the laundry. Make certain you have a strainer on your washing machine hose to keep out these potentially problematic materials. Another blockage that might happen is within the pipes. Water heater maintenance

Your water heater is the other significant home appliance in the basement. This helpful device manages the temperature of the water in all of your sinks, tubs and showers. In order to keep your bathing and dishwashing routines comfortable and not too hot, you'll have to periodically do some maintenance on your hot water heater. To keep yours running and in great condition, you'll have to flush the tank and examine the anode rod each year..

To flush your tank, first turn off the electrical energy and water to the heater. Then wait several hours for it to cool. When you can touch the tank and is no longer warm, utilize a garden hose and pump to drain it. The water coming from the tank needs to be poured into a pail so you can see exactly what color it is. Dark water suggests there is a lot of mineral accumulation. This can corrode your tank and trigger issues with the temperature level. Refill the tank with clean water then repeat this draining pipes process up until the water is clear. Eliminate your pipe and pump and switch on both the water and electrical energy so your hot water heater can return to its typical functioning.
